Skills-based Board Toolkit

Shared by AFHTO & Collaborative Solutions  Created March 2018 A skills-based board toolkit has been prepared for teams. The toolkit, prepared by governance consultant Catherine Anastakis, provides an overview of current thinking about board skills and skills-based boards, as well as practical tools and tips for enhancing the skills capacity of any board. Board Chair Leadership Council – Updates to AFHTO Members

The Board Chair Leadership Council (BCLC) enables FHT and NPLC board chairs to collaboratively identify and raise governance issues, and to advance knowledge transfer across the province for governance best practices. LeaderShift Webinars – The Health Care Sytem and Health Care Reform

On April 19 and 26, 2018, LeaderShift webinars were hosted by the Ontario Community Support Association (OCSA). LeaderShift is a new leadership development project being led by the OCSA in partnership with AFHTO, the Association of Ontario Health Centres, and Addictions and Mental Health Ontario.
